Transaction 61bba56ffd50bad601386fea36226e9abab84ba1289260307632cb6a1d1252a3
1 Input
1 Output
-
61bba56ffd50bad601386fea36226e9abab84ba1289260307632cb6a1d1252a3:0
- value
- 19980356
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a856ad0a9b1f5c3bd6e9c2ed8294c0814ab19db
- address
- bc1qp2zk459fk86u80twnshds22vpq22kxwmw0lqff